4 years ago I founded Immersive Rehab with the vision to help improve neurorehabilitation services and the access to it for people affected by neurological conditions like stroke, multiple sclerosis and spinal injury. We are still working every day on delivering on our mission and bring our vision to life. I would like to thank our clinical partners for their trust in our approach, the patients we have worked with so far and their feedback, our corporate partners and collaborators, and our support network of advisors, investors and fellow entrepreneurs.
I look forward to continue the journey with them with the aim to improve overall outcomes for patients affected by neurological disorders.
